S8E4: The Death of the GRC Moat
That million dollar GRC pricing sheet on your screen might be selling you the digital equivalent of a 1980s filing cabinet. We pull apart why governance, risk, and compliance software suddenly looks like a gold rush in 2026, and why the old buying signals no longer work. The key shift: storing and linking risk data is largely a commodity, and even “enterprise hardening” security features are increasingly just cloud configuration. If a vendor’s big flex is secure storage plus a polished dashboard, we explain why that’s not a premium platform anymore.
From there, we move up the stack into the system of engagement, where AI-assisted development is making forms, workflows, and routing logic shockingly cheap to build. We also tackle the semantic interpretation layer, the work compliance teams and consultants used to do manually: reading regulations, mapping controls to frameworks like SOC 2 and GDPR, and producing evidence. Large language models are compressing that labor into software, shifting budgets away from services and toward platforms that can maintain compliance mappings continuously.
The real question becomes: where is the value now? Our answer is the system of action, where agentic AI can see cross-domain context and execute accountable remediation across systems, not just suggest text or summarize documents. We share concrete demo questions to separate a chatbot “clerk” from an AI “officer,” plus a hard warning drawn from the Delve collapse about what happens when speed and marketing outrun foundational integrity.
